
这些软件不仅允许用户在同一物理机上运行多个操作系统,还极大地简化了测试、开发和部署流程
然而,在使用VMware时,用户有时会遇到一个令人头疼的问题:尝试打开VMX(VMware虚拟机配置文件)文件时,VMware软件没有任何反应
这一状况不仅影响了工作效率,还可能引发一系列后续问题
本文将深入探讨这一现象的原因、诊断方法以及一系列行之有效的解决方案,旨在帮助用户迅速摆脱困境,恢复虚拟机的正常运行
一、问题概述 VMX文件是VMware虚拟机配置文件的核心,它包含了虚拟机运行所需的所有配置信息,如操作系统类型、内存分配、硬盘位置等
当VMware无法响应VMX文件的打开请求时,通常意味着软件在读取或解析该配置文件时遇到了障碍
这一问题可能由多种因素引起,包括但不限于文件损坏、权限设置不当、VMware软件故障、系统兼容性问题等
二、问题诊断 面对VMware打开VMX文件无反应的情况,首要任务是进行问题诊断,以确定问题的根源
以下是一些关键的排查步骤: 1.检查VMX文件完整性 - 确认VMX文件是否存在于预期位置
- 使用文本编辑器(如Notepad++或Sublime Text)尝试打开VMX文件,检查是否存在乱码或明显的数据损坏迹象
- 对比正常工作的VMX文件,查看是否有异常配置项
2.验证文件权限 - 确保当前用户账户对VMX文件及其所在目录拥有足够的读取权限
- 在Windows系统中,可以通过右键点击文件/文件夹,选择“属性”,然后在“安全”标签页中检查权限设置
- 在macOS或Linux中,使用`ls -l`命令查看文件权限,必要时使用`chmod`和`chown`命令调整
3.检查VMware软件状态 - 确保VMware Workstation或Fusion软件是最新版本,或者至少是一个已知稳定的版本
- 尝试重启VMware软件,有时简单的重启可以解决临时性的软件故障
- 检查VMware的日志文件(通常位于`C:Users<用户名>DocumentsVMwarelog`或类似路径),查找与打开VMX文件相关的错误或警告信息
4.系统兼容性检查 - 确认你的操作系统版本与VMware软件版本兼容
- 检查是否有必要的系统更新或补丁未安装,这些更新可能包含对VMware软件的支持改进
5.硬件资源评估 - 检查系统资源(如CPU、内存、磁盘空间)是否充足,因为资源不足也可能导致VMware无法正常启动虚拟机
- 特别是内存使用情况,虚拟机运行需要消耗大量内存,确保系统未处于内存满载状态
三、解决方案 根据诊断结果,可以采取以下一种或多种解决方案来尝试解决问题: 1.修复或替换VMX文件 - 如果VMX文件损坏,尝试从备份中恢复
- 如果没有备份,可以尝试创建一个新的虚拟机,并手动迁移旧虚拟机中的重要数据和配置到新创建的VMX文件中(注意,这需要一定的技术基础)
2.调整文件权限 - 根据之前的权限检查结果,修改VMX文件及其所在目录的权限设置,确保当前用户能够完全访问
3.更新或重装VMware软件 - 访问VMware官方网站,下载并安装最新版本的VMware Workstation或Fusion
- 如果更新后问题依旧,考虑完全卸载当前版本,清理残留文件(使用专业的卸载工具或手动删除相关文件夹),然后重新安装
4.解决系统兼容性问题 - 如果发现是由于系统不兼容导致的问题,考虑升级操作系统或降级到与VMware软件兼容的操作系统版本
- 安装所有必要的系统更新和补丁,确保系统环境稳定
5.优化系统资源分配 - 关闭不必要的后台应用程序和服务,释放系统资源
- 增加物理内存(RAM),如果经常需要运行多个虚拟机或大型应用
- 清理磁盘空间,确保有足够的空间供虚拟机使用
6.使用命令行启动虚拟机 - 对于高级用户,可以尝试使用VMware的命令行工具(如`vmrun`或`vmware-cmd`)来启动虚拟机,这有时可以绕过图形界面的限制
7.联系技术支持 - 如果上述方法均未能解决问题,建议联系VMware官方技术支持,提供详细的错误日志和问题描述,以获取专业的帮助
四、预防措施 为了避免未来再次遇到类似问题,可以采取以下预防措施: - 定期备份:定期备份VMX文件及其关联的虚拟机文件夹,以防数据丢失或损坏
- 保持软件更新:定期检查并安装VMware软件的更新和补丁,确保软件始终处于最佳状态
- 合理管理资源:监控和管理系统资源,避免资源过度使用导致性能下降或软件故障
- 权限管理:谨慎设置文件和文件夹的权限,确保只有授权用户能够访问和修改关键配置
- 系统维护:定期进行系统维护,包括磁盘清理、碎片整理、系统更新等,以保持系统健康
五、结语 VMware打开VMX文件无反应的问题虽然令人困扰,但通过系统的诊断步骤和有效的解决方案,大多数用户都能成功解决问题,恢复虚拟机的正常运行
重要的是,保持耐心和细致,逐步排查可能的原因,并采取适当的措施进行修复
同时,通过实施预防措施,可以降低未来再次遇到类似问题的风险,提升工作效率和虚拟机的稳定性
希望本文能为你解决VMware相关问题提供有价值的参考和指导
VMware 10.0.4 注册码获取指南
VMware打开VMX无反应?解决攻略来了!
Win10家庭版虚拟机实用指南
Windows 11能否安装虚拟机?详细教程来了!
VMware使用常见问题解析
VM虚拟机安装Win7高效分区指南
VMware虚拟机与主机IP配置指南
VMware 10.0.4 注册码获取指南
VMware使用常见问题解析
VMware虚拟机与主机IP配置指南
VMware虚拟机安装鸿蒙系统指南
VMware虚拟机光驱启动指南
VMware上安装MIUI9教程
平板也能装VMware?高效办公新技巧
Win10虚拟机:VMware安装全攻略
VMware虚拟磁盘文件写入指南
VMware10 USB设备无法识别解决方案
VMware加网卡,Linux却无法识别怎么办
VMware技巧:轻松解锁键盘锁定问题